HORIZONTAL/VERTICAL IMAGE POSITION, IMAGE AMPLITUDE AND IMAGE DISTORTION ADJUSTMENTS (HDTV UNDERSCAN MODE)
Measuring Instruments
Signal generator (Size adjustment signal, Crosshatch signal)
Card (Slot)
Component/RGB Input Card (Slot 1)
Test Points
Adjustment Points
D*01 (Horizontal Size), D*02 (Vertical Size), D*03 (Horizontal Position), D*04 (Vertical Position),
D*05 (Side Pin Distortion), D*06 (Corner Distortion (W)), D*07 (Corner Distortion (S)), D*08
(Parallelogram Distortion), D*09 (Trapezoidal Distortion), D*10 (Horizontal Arc Distortion), D*11
(Vertical Linearity (S Correction)), D*12 (Vertical Linearity (C Correction)) [Service Menu]
Note:
•
Perform the following adjustments after completing
the Reference Mode (HDTV overscan mode)
adjustments.
(1) Apply the 1080/60i size adjustment signal to INPUT A
(Terminal Y on the Component/RGB Input Card).
(2) Set the CONTRAST and BRIGHT potentiometers on the
front panel to the center click positions.
(3) Press the UNDER SCAN button on the front panel to set
the scanning size to underscanning.
(4) Adjust
DN04
in the Service Menu to set the vertical position
of the image at the center of the CRT screen.
(5) Adjust
DN02
to set the vertical amplitude of the image to
175mm
.
(6) Apply the 1080/60i crosshatch signal to INPUT A.
(7) Adjust
DN11
to set the sizes of the rectangles at the center
of the image and those at the left and right ends to be
identical.
(8) Adjust
DN12
to set the sizes of the rectangles at the center
of the image and those at the top and bottom to be identical.
(9) Ensure that the center position is not deviated. If it is, adjust
DN04
again.
(10)Adjust
DN11
,
DN12
and
DN04
repeatedly until the center
position and vertical linearity are optimized.
(11) Adjust
DN09
to optimize the trapezoidal distortion (observe
the second vertical lines from the left and right edges as the
reference).
(12)Adjust
DN08
to optimize the parallelogram distortion
(observe the second vertical lines from the left and right
edges as the reference).
(13)Adjust
DN10
to optimize the horizontal arc distortion.
(14)Adjust
DN05
so that the second vertical lines from the left
and right edges are linear.
(15)If there is an extreme corner S-shape distortion, adjust
DN07
to optimize it (this adjustment is usually unnecessary).
(16)If there is an extreme corner W-shape distortion, adjust
DN06
to optimize it (this adjustment is usually unnecessary).
(17)Apply the 1080/60i size adjustment signal to INPUT A.
(18)Ensure that the vertical amplitude of the image is
175mm
. If
it is not, adjust
DN02
again.
(19)Adjust
DN03
so that the horizontal position of the image
comes at the center of the CRT screen.
(20)Adjust
DN01
to set the horizontal amplitude of the image to
311mm
.
(21)Vary the adjustment signal and adjustment data, and re-
perform adjustments in steps 1 to 20 above (see Table 9).
